Kann jemand bitte erklären, welchen Vorteil die Verwendung der Fields-API zum Erstellen von Feldern für eine Entität hat, anstatt sie nur in hook_schema als Werte zu deklarieren?
Es ist ein bisschen Arbeit, alle Felder, Instanzen, Optionen, zulässigen und Standardwerte usw. zu definieren, und dann müssen Sie sich mit Gettern und Setzern befassen, und schließlich ist die Deinstallation nicht so einfach wie db_delete, insbesondere wenn Sie Referenzfelder haben in Verwendung durch andere Entitäten.